Insurance History
Insuring highly expensive Indy Type Racing Cars was conceived by me in 1993 the year that I retired from Indy Car racing. At that time there was only one Major Open Wheel series in the USA. The CART Indy Car series and Two minor series the Formula Atlantic Series and the Indy Lights series.

I wanted to remain involved with racing after my retirement and created the idea to insure the Indy type race cars for crash damage. For six months I researched and compiled an actuarial that covered the years 1989 through 1993. I had both crash damage data for every track and the cost of the repairs. I went to London UK with this information and presented the idea to the underwriters at Lloyds of London and other London companies. My insurance program was successfully presented and they agreed with the idea to insure the cars. That was the start of my insurance program.
With my unique and comprehensive knowledge of racing and race car construction I was the ideal person to perform the claims administration for the program. Claims Management is the key to success for both the underwriting companies and the team owners.
The coverage is similar to a combination of traditional automobile collision and comprehensive coverages. Basically it covers the race cars for Collision, Upset and Fire while on the racetrack. This includes practicing, qualifying and racing. Testing coverage is an option.
This coverage is known as "On Track Physical Damage."
Over the years, I have expanded my business and branched out to all areas of Motorsports insurance. I now offer General Liability, Personal Accident, Prize Indemnity, Workers Comp, Disability and all necessary foreign coverage as well as Owner & Sponsor Liability. In addition I offer Participant Accident coverage for race facilities.
